Counseling Children

Presenting Problems:

Many of Stein Counseling professionals have experience working with children and their potential presenting problems, such as:

  • fear
  • trauma – physical abuse, sexual abuse, domestic violence, natural disaster, rape
  • traumatic grief
  • anxiety
  • depression
  • sibling rivalry
  • perfectionism
  • difficult adjustments (divorce, move, new school)
  • aggression
  • defiance
  • attention-deficit disorder
  • poor academic performance
  • disruptive behavior
  • attachment related insecurities
  • grief due to death or other loss
  • bullying
  • bullying-victim
  • anger
  • low self-esteem
  • other mental health issues
